Asp.net mvc MVC中的缓存位置
我正在学习MVC中缓存的概念,正在阅读这篇文章。OutputCache属性“Location”的属性具有以下可能的值: 任意(默认):内容缓存在三个位置:web服务器、任意代理服务器和web浏览器 客户端:内容缓存在web浏览器上 服务器:内容缓存在web服务器上 ServerAndClient:内容缓存在web服务器和web浏览器上 无:内容不会缓存在任何位置Asp.net mvc MVC中的缓存位置,asp.net-mvc,caching,server,client,outputcache,Asp.net Mvc,Caching,Server,Client,Outputcache,我正在学习MVC中缓存的概念,正在阅读这篇文章。OutputCache属性“Location”的属性具有以下可能的值: 任意(默认):内容缓存在三个位置:web服务器、任意代理服务器和web浏览器 客户端:内容缓存在web浏览器上 服务器:内容缓存在web服务器上 ServerAndClient:内容缓存在web服务器和web浏览器上 无:内容不会缓存在任何位置 我想知道什么时候我们会使用位置值Client和Server,为什么我们会选择一个而不是另一个。如果要缓存特定于用户的信息,请选择Ser
我想知道什么时候我们会使用位置值
Client
和Server
,为什么我们会选择一个而不是另一个。如果要缓存特定于用户的信息,请选择Server选项。例如,如果视图返回登录用户,则需要使用服务器选项。如果所有用户的视图内容相同,则使用“客户端”选项,它将缓存在浏览器中 如果要缓存特定于用户的信息,请选择服务器选项。例如,如果视图返回登录用户,则需要使用服务器选项。如果所有用户的视图内容相同,则使用“客户端”选项,它将缓存在浏览器中 我想你说的正好相反。没有?没有。你可以试一试。如果你在客户端缓存,那么它有相同的页面内容。你说的是相反的。我猜你说的是相反的。没有?没有。你可以试一试。如果您在客户端缓存,则它具有相同的页面内容。您的说法正好相反。